Yes, I bet, it's not related with Dashboard, although the error message tells you so. Which version are you installing from where? Do you see other issues with your openstack-installation? Please note, the minimum required set of OpenStack services running includes the following: + Nova (compute, api, scheduler, network, and volume services) + Glance + Keystone Instead of nova volume, you could also use cinder volume. Did you install there and are they working ok?
